Communications Specialist

The Communications Specialist is responsible for developing, implementing, and managing internal and external communication strategies that promote the organization’s brand, mission, and key initiatives. This role creates compelling content, ensures message consistency, coordinates print and digital materials, publishes content and supports engagement across multiple channels.
